Sainz on other F1 teams: 'They are a step ahead'

Carlos Sainz finished in sixth place at the Saudi Arabia Grand Prix, well behind number one, Sergio Perez, by 35 seconds. Although Ferrari was still keeping up well with Red Bull last season, it is now noticeable that the gap between the two teams is huge. Article continues under ad "It is the harsh reality, they are one step ahead, especially in terms of race pace." False start Scuderia Ferrari had a false start in Bahrain by finishing with a DNF and a fourth place for Sainz. Results were also very disappointing in Jeddah, although the Italian team did pick up more points than last weekend, as the gap between Mercedes and Aston Martin is starting to widen.
